HIGH COURT OF UTTARAKHAND STAYS RESERVATION OF WOMEN WITH DOMICILE IN STATE CIVIL SERVICES

HIGH COURT OF UTTARAKHAND STAY

NAINITAL, August 24, 2022 (TBINN)
Uttarakhand High Court today put a stay on 30 per cent reservation of women having domicile of the state in State Civil Services Examination.
Bench, headed by Chief Justice Vipin Sanghi and Justice R.C. Khulbe, put a hold on the 2006-order in this regard.
